Error When Trying To Add Costs To Rate Records With Non ASCII Characters in Names (Doc ID 838980.1)

Last updated on JULY 20, 2024

Applies to:

Oracle Transportation Management - Version 5.5.03 to 5.5.05 [Release 5.5]
Information in this document applies to any platform.
This problem can occur on any platform.

Symptoms

-- Problem Statement:
You are able to create a rate record with non-ASCII characters (for example Š, Ç) in its naming convention, however, when trying to edit the rate and add a new rate cost, the following error message appears:

ERROR
Unable to find group in XML

-- Steps To Reproduce:

1. Go to Contract and Rate Management > Contract Management > Rate Record > create a new rate record with a name which includes non-standard characters and add a rate cost.

2. Edit the newly created rate and go to the Rate Cost tab and click on "Add A Cost".

3. The error "Unable to find group in XML" will be displayed
